Treatment for gastroesophageal reflux disease (gerd) depends on the severity of a child or teen’s symptoms and may include lifestyle changes, medicines, or surgery. eating, diet, & nutrition a child or teen can reduce gastroesophageal reflux (ger) by avoiding foods and drinks that make his or her symptoms worse.. Gastroesophageal reflux disease (gerd), also known as acid reflux, is a long-term condition in which stomach contents rise up into the esophagus, resulting in either symptoms or complications. symptoms include the taste of acid in the back of the mouth, heartburn, bad breath, chest pain, regurgitation, breathing problems, and wearing away of the teeth..
